Mortal Love

Mine is a mortal love-
made of
thirst and hunger,
craving and desire,
impatience and anger.

Mine is a-
mortal love of a mortal being,
fleshy love of a fleshy being,
bloody love of a bloody being.
Is that a surprise to you?

whenever I see your garden,
I feel like plundering it.
whenever I see your sweet river
I feel like swallowing it.

I am always
hunting you, craving you.
Always.

Spent and exhausted
when I fall asleep in night-
I see your beautiful naked garden
with fruits waving at me, flowers smiling to me.
Their aroma, their colour, their contour,
they all make me wild and impatient.
My heart aches longing to eat your tenderness.
My soul cries longing to drink your sweetness.

I never can trust myself
in your inviting presence.
Your thirsty eyes turn me to a pounding wolf,
your juicy lips turn me to a hungry bull,
your golden valley turns me to a wild ox
who wants to plunder everything he sees.

I never can be decent
in your delightful presence.
Heaven or hell, does not bother me;
sin or virtue, does not bother me;
suffering or death, does not bother me.

For your flesh,
I am ready to suffer an eternity of damnation.
For your fragrance,
I am ready to die and decay, in dungeon of hell.

Call me a beast if you like,
call me a leech if you like,
call me anything you like.
But I am what I am.
I am a mortal being with mortal love.
A love full of desire for flesh and blood.

But remember,
it's not just anyone's flesh and blood.
It's, only your flesh and blood.
Yours, only yours.
